PrivLoc:防止地理围栏服务中的位置跟踪
在当今数字化时代,地理围栏服务的应用越来越广泛,但用户的位置隐私保护也成为了一个重要问题。本文将介绍一种名为PrivLoc的解决方案,它可以在不泄露用户隐私的前提下,实现地理围栏服务的外包。
1. 背景知识
- 空间数据库 :空间数据库是专门用于存储和查询几何空间中对象数据的数据库。常见的空间数据库有MongoDB、MySQL、PostgreSQL等。为了高效处理和存储空间数据,空间数据库依赖于空间数据库管理系统(SDBMS),它扩展了传统数据库管理系统的功能。SDBMS通常支持三种类型的查询:
- 集合运算符(如不相交、接触、包含)
- 空间分析(如距离、交集)
- 其他基本功能,如边界框、边界等
这些查询通过空间索引(如R树、X树、GiST)来高效实现。例如,R树用最小边界矩形来表示对象,其核心思想是,如果一个查询不与边界矩形相交,那么它也不可能与包含的任何对象相交。
- 系统模型 :
- 移动节点 :存在移动节点M(如移动设备、传感器),它们会定期向云端的地理围栏服务发送位置报告。每个节点Mi会发送形式为⟨IDi, Loci⟩的位置信标,其中IDi是节点的标识符,Loci是节点Mi的最后一次移动向量。
- 数据库服务器 :由多个数据库服务器组成的“逻辑”数据库D,为客户提供基于位置的服务。
超级会员免费看
订阅专栏 解锁全文
783

被折叠的 条评论
为什么被折叠?



